数据库推荐什么书最好

不及物动词 其他 16

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    推荐以下几本数据库相关的书籍:

    1.《数据库系统概念》(Database System Concepts) – 作者:Silberschatz、Korth、Sudarshan
    这本书是数据库领域的经典之作,涵盖了数据库系统的基本概念、原理和技术。适合初学者和想要全面了解数据库系统的读者。

    2.《SQL必知必会》(SQL in 10 Minutes a Day) – 作者:Ben Forta
    这本书是一本简洁明了的SQL入门指南,适合那些想要快速学习和掌握SQL语言的读者。书中通过简单易懂的示例和练习帮助读者掌握SQL查询和操作数据库的基本技能。

    3.《高性能MySQL》(High Performance MySQL) – 作者:Baron Schwartz、Peter Zaitsev、Vadim Tkachenko、Jeremy D. Zawodny、Arjen Lentz、Derek J. Balling
    这本书深入讲解了MySQL数据库的性能优化和调优技术,包括查询优化、索引优化、存储引擎选择等方面的内容。适合那些已经熟悉MySQL并希望提升数据库性能的读者。

    4.《数据库索引设计与优化》(Database Indexing: Design and Performance Optimization) – 作者:Dmitri Ilchenko
    这本书详细介绍了数据库索引的设计原理和优化策略,包括B树、哈希索引、全文索引等不同类型的索引技术。适合那些想要深入了解和优化数据库索引的读者。

    5.《NoSQL精粹》(NoSQL Distilled: A Brief Guide to the Emerging World of Polyglot Persistence) – 作者:Pramod J. Sadalage、Martin Fowler
    这本书介绍了NoSQL数据库的概念、分类以及各种NoSQL数据库的特点和适用场景。适合那些想要了解和应用NoSQL数据库的读者。

    除了以上几本书籍,还可以根据自己的具体需求和兴趣选择其他数据库相关的书籍,比如特定数据库产品的深入指南、数据库安全和备份恢复等方面的书籍。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    推荐一本好的数据库书籍是《数据库系统概念》(Database System Concepts)。

    《数据库系统概念》是由Silberschatz、Korth和Sudarshan合著的一本经典数据库教材。该书以清晰的语言和详细的示例,全面介绍了数据库系统的基本概念、原理和技术。

    首先,该书从数据库系统的基本概念入手,讲解了数据库的定义、特点以及数据库管理系统(DBMS)的功能和组成部分。然后,介绍了关系数据模型和关系代数,让读者了解关系数据库的基本原理和操作。

    接着,书中详细介绍了关系数据库的设计和规范化过程,包括实体-关系模型、关系模式、关系规范化等。这部分内容对于数据库设计和优化非常重要。

    此外,该书还涵盖了数据库查询语言(SQL)的基本语法和高级特性,包括查询、更新、事务和并发控制等方面。SQL是关系数据库最重要的操作语言,掌握SQL的基本知识对于使用和管理数据库至关重要。

    最后,书中还介绍了数据库安全和完整性、分布式数据库、数据仓库和数据挖掘等高级主题。这些内容使读者能够深入理解数据库系统在现实世界中的应用和挑战。

    总之,《数据库系统概念》是一本内容全面、结构清晰、适合初学者和专业人士阅读的数据库教材。无论是想要学习数据库基础知识,还是希望深入了解数据库系统的高级特性,这本书都是一个很好的选择。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在选择数据库相关的书籍时,可以根据自己的需求和水平进行选择。以下是一些推荐的数据库书籍,根据不同的需求进行分类:

    入门级:

    1. 《数据库系统概念》(原书第7版)作者:Abraham Silberschatz、Henry F. Korth、S. Sudarshan
      这本书是数据库领域的经典教材之一,适合初学者入门。书中对数据库基本概念、关系模型、SQL语言、事务管理等内容进行了详细讲解。

    2. 《数据库设计与实现》(原书第4版)作者:Michael Mannino
      这本书重点介绍了数据库设计的基本原则和技巧,涵盖了关系数据库、实体关系模型、范式、关系代数等内容。适合初学者系统学习数据库设计和实现的方法。

    进阶级:

    1. 《数据库系统实现》(原书第2版)作者:Hector Garcia-Molina、Jeffrey D. Ullman、Jennifer Widom
      这本书详细介绍了数据库系统的实现原理,包括存储管理、查询优化、并发控制、恢复和安全等方面的内容。适合有一定数据库基础的读者进一步深入学习。

    2. 《数据库系统概论》(原书第3版)作者:Ramez Elmasri、Shamkant B. Navathe
      这本书综合性地介绍了数据库系统的理论和实践,包括数据模型、关系数据库设计、SQL语言、查询优化、并发控制、恢复和安全等内容。适合想要全面了解数据库系统的读者。

    专业级:

    1. 《数据库系统概念》(原书第6版)作者:C. J. Date
      这本书是数据库领域的经典著作之一,介绍了关系数据库理论的基本概念和原理,包括关系模型、范式理论、关系代数和SQL语言等内容。适合有一定数据库基础和理论基础的读者。

    2. 《数据库管理系统》(原书第3版)作者:Raghu Ramakrishnan、Johannes Gehrke
      这本书深入介绍了数据库管理系统的各个方面,包括关系模型、SQL语言、查询优化、并发控制、恢复和安全等内容。适合想要深入研究数据库管理系统的读者。

    除了以上推荐的书籍,还可以根据自己的具体需求选择其他适合的数据库相关书籍。在选择书籍时,可以参考书籍的作者、出版社、评价和读者的反馈等方面的信息,以便更好地选择适合自己的书籍。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部